Each coating is precision applied and covers the entire surface area of the plain steel wire mesh for strength and durability. 

 

Epoxy coated plain steel screen mesh is made by using the principle of electrostatic spraying to absorb eco-friendly epoxy resin powder on the surface of the plain steel wire mesh, after a certain time of high temperature curing, the epoxy resin powder is melted and covered on the plain steel mesh, so a dense protective layer is formed.

Advantages of Jiushen Epoxy Coated Plain Steel Wire Mesh

Size and Appearance

Precise Size and Smooth Appearance: After epoxy coating treatment, the mesh surface is square with no deformation, flat with a maximum fluctuation height on the platform ≤10mm, high size accuracy, and excellent appearance quality.


Coating Process

Moderate Powder Amount and Reasonable Interweaving: The powder amount is controlled at 20-35g/㎡, ensuring both protective performance and flexibility of the steel wire for optimal product balance.


High-Quality Powder, Certification Support: Surface treatment uses oil-resistant and corrosion-resistant low-temperature fast-curing oil-based matting resin paint and weather-resistant polyester paint. Both have passed RoHS and REACH certifications, ensuring environmental friendliness and excellent performance.


Performance

Oil-Resistant and Corrosion-Resistant, Widely Applicable: Excellent resistance to oil and corrosion, withstands hydraulic oil media tests under varying temperatures and durations. The coating surface remains unchanged, suitable for high-temperature and high-pressure hydraulic filtration products.

Strong Weather Resistance and Environmental Friendliness: According to ASTM B117-09 salt spray test standards, the coating shows no change after 96 hours of continuous testing, making it ideal for air filtration and outdoor use in harsh environments.

Strong Adhesion, Strong and Durable: The coating tightly bonds with the steel wire, passing H-level pencil tests, 1kg/50cm impact tests, scratch tests, and anti-fatigue tests to ensure long-term durability without peeling.

High Bendability, Flexible and Foldable: Excellent bending performance allows folding around a 1mm radius steel rod without cracking, offering good flexibility and ease of processing.


Material and Processing

High-Quality Materials, Exquisite Craftsmanship: Made from industrial-grade high-quality steel, using wire drawing annealing and innovative weaving processes, resulting in a soft mesh surface, low elastic modulus, and excellent product quality.


Easy to Process and Shape, Not Easy to Fall Off: After coating, the mesh is easy to fold and shape. Warp and weft wires remain tightly combined, edges do not peel after cutting, ensuring high stability, reliability, and safe usage.

How does Epoxy Coated Plain Steel Wire Mesh Work

Epoxy Coated Plain Steel Wire Mesh works by combining the mechanical strength of steel wire with the protective properties of an epoxy resin coating. The base material is plain steel wire, which is first drawn, straightened, and woven into a uniform mesh structure. This creates a strong grid that provides structural support and reinforcement in various applications such as construction, fencing, filtration, and industrial flooring.

After the mesh is formed, it undergoes a surface treatment process to ensure proper adhesion of the coating. The steel is typically cleaned and sometimes lightly roughened to remove oil, rust, and impurities. Then, an epoxy powder or liquid coating is applied evenly over the entire surface of the wire mesh. In many modern processes, electrostatic spraying is used so that the epoxy particles are attracted to the grounded steel surface, ensuring uniform coverage.

Once coated, the mesh is heated in a curing oven. During this stage, the epoxy material melts, flows, and chemically cross-links to form a hard, continuous protective layer around each steel wire. This cured epoxy layer acts as a barrier, preventing moisture, oxygen, and chemicals from directly contacting the steel surface.


Epoxy Coated Plain Steel Wire Mesh Advantages

Epoxy Coated Plain Steel Wire Mesh offers several important advantages that make it widely used in filtration, construction and industrial applications.

First, it has excellent corrosion resistance. The epoxy coating forms a continuous protective barrier that prevents moisture, oxygen, and chemicals from reaching the steel surface. This greatly reduces rust formation, especially in humid, coastal, or chemically aggressive environments.

Second, it provides high durability and long service life. Compared with uncoated steel mesh, the epoxy layer significantly slows down wear and environmental damage, allowing the material to maintain its performance for many years with minimal maintenance.

Third, it has good mechanical strength. The steel core retains its original tensile strength and rigidity, so the mesh can effectively support reinforcement, load distribution, and structural stability in filtration or protective systems.

Finally, it is cost-effective in the long term. Although the initial cost may be higher than plain steel mesh, reduced maintenance and longer lifespan make it more economical overall.
